What Makes a Great Social Scheduling Tool in 2026?
Not all social schedulers are built the same. In 2026, the best social scheduling tools do far more than queue up posts; they help streamline your workflow, improve performance, and make managing multiple accounts significantly easier. Whether you’re a creator, freelancer, or part of a growing marketing team, the right tool can make or break you.
When considering a social media scheduling tool, here are some must-have features to look for:
- Visual content planner
- Multi-platform publishing
- AI caption or hashtag tracking
- Best-time-to-post recommendations
- Analytics and reporting
- Team collaboration tools
- Approval workflows
- Client management

How to Choose the Right Social Scheduling Tool
The best social scheduling tool depends on how you work, what platforms you manage, and how much complexity you need. For example, a solo creator may want something fast and visual, while agencies and social media managers often need reporting, collaboration, and multi-account control. Before choosing a platform, focus on the features that match your daily workflow and future growth.
If You’re a Creator
Prioritize ease of use, visual planning, and quick scheduling tools that help you stay consistent without adding extra work. A clean content calendar makes it easier to map out campaigns, maintain your aesthetic, and avoid last-minute posting stress. Cross-platform publishing is also a major advantage if you’re active on Instagram, TikTok, YouTube Shorts, and more.
If You’re a Freelancer
Look for client management features, reporting tools, and the ability to manage multiple brands from one dashboard. When you’re balancing several accounts, switching between platforms can waste valuable time. A tool that simplifies approvals, content planning, and monthly reporting can help you scale your freelance business more efficiently.
If You’re a Social Media Manager
Choose a platform with collaboration tools, approval workflows, analytics, and performance reporting. Managing a team often means coordinating designers, writers, clients, and stakeholders, so streamlined communication matters. The right tool should help your team move faster, stay organized, and, most of all, make smarter, data-driven decisions.

Pro Tips for Better Social Media Scheduling
Having the right tool is only part of the equation. How you use it matters just as much, if not more. A smart social media scheduling strategy can help you stay consistent, save time, and improve performance without feeling chained to your phone. Use these tips to get more out of your content calendar in 2026:
- Batch create content weekly so you can stay ahead instead of scrambling to post every day. Creating in batches can help you keep your messaging more consistent.
- Schedule at audience peak times to increase reach and interactions when your followers are most active. Many tools like Metricool now recommend the best times to post.
- Repurpose top-performing posts by turning successful content into new formats, captions, or platform-specific versions. Great content should work more than once.
- Track analytics monthly to understand what is working, what isn’t, and where to adjust your strategy. Consistent reviews lead to smarter growth.
- Stay flexible for new trends and leave room in your schedule for viral moments, breaking news, or timely conversations within your social niche.
